Mawkyrdang - Mairang, Eastern West Khasi Hills
Mawkyrdang is a village situated in the Mairang subdivision of Eastern West Khasi Hills district, Meghalaya. It is located approximately 20 km from Mairang and around 69 km from Nongstoin.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Mawkyrdang is 277067. The village falls under the 793120 pincode.
Mawkyrdang village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system. For political representation, the village falls under the Mawthadraishan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Shillong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Mawkyrdang
As per Census 2011, Mawkyrdang village has a total population of 554 people, consisting of 274 males and 280 females. The village has 87 households and a sex ratio of 1,021 females per 1,000 males. There are 118 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 263 literate and 291 illiterate residents. Additionally, 551 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Mawkyrdang
Mawkyrdang is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Nongstoin to Mawkyrdang is about 69 km, with the usual travel time around ~2 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
